W integracji xSale z Subiekt Nexo obsługa międzynarodowych stawek VAT działa zarówno dla sprzedaży rozliczanej w procedurze OSS, jak i dla sprzedaży zagranicznej poza OSS. Sposób zapisania zamówienia zależy od kraju dostawy, rodzaju klienta oraz ustawień integracji.
W tym artykule znajdziesz
- jak działa obsługa międzynarodowych stawek VAT w Subiekt Nexo,
- jak włączyć obsługę OSS i typu transakcji,
- jakie scenariusze obsługuje integracja,
- o czym warto pamiętać przy konfiguracji.
Jak działa obsługa międzynarodowych stawek VAT
Przy zapisie zamówienia do Subiekt Nexo xSale bierze pod uwagę:
- czy kupujący ma numer NIP,
- kraj dostawy,
- czy w integracji włączona jest procedura OSS,
- czy włączone jest ustawianie typu transakcji na podstawie numeru NIP.
Dzięki temu integracja może poprawnie rozróżnić sprzedaż krajową, sprzedaż unijną B2B, sprzedaż unijną B2C w procedurze OSS, sprzedaż unijną B2C bez OSS oraz sprzedaż poza Unię Europejską.
Jak włączyć obsługę OSS i typu transakcji
Aby uruchomić tę obsługę, przejdź w xSale do sekcji Integracje -> Subiekt Nexo -> Synchronizacja zamówień i zaznacz opcje:
- Stosuj procedurę OSS, jeśli chcesz rozliczać sprzedaż B2C do krajów UE w procedurze OSS,
- Ustaw typ transakcji na podstawie numeru NIP, jeśli chcesz, aby xSale rozróżniał scenariusze B2B i B2C na podstawie numeru NIP kupującego.

Po zmianie konfiguracji przejdź do aplikacji Futuriti Connector zainstalowanej na serwerze i wybierz opcję Instaluj, aktualizuj – zastosuj zmiany.

Jakie scenariusze obsługuje integracja
W standardowej konfiguracji integracja zapisuje zamówienia w Subiekt Nexo według poniższych zasad:
| Scenariusz (typ kontrahenta i sprzedaży) | Scenariusz obsługiwany przez xSale? | Zamówienie xSale | Subiekt Nexo | ||||
| NIP – Kupujący | Kraj | Kod kraju ISO przed NIP oraz nazwa kraju na kontrahencie | Karta kontrahenta -> Indywidualne -> Transakcja VAT sprzedaży
+ na dokumencie ZK, FS, WZ |
Stawka VAT towar | Stawka VAT transport | ||
| 1. Kontrahent krajowy B2B | Tak | NIP | PL | nie jest konieczny | Sprzedaż krajowa | Subiekt powinien ustawić sam z karty | Subiekt powinien ustawić sam z karty |
| 2. Kontrahent krajowy B2C | Tak | brak | PL | nie jest konieczny | Sprzedaż krajowa | Subiekt powinien ustawić sam z karty | Subiekt powinien ustawić sam z karty |
| 3. Kontrahent UE B2B | Tak | NIP | UE | konieczny | Wewnątrzwspólnotowa dostawa towarów | Subiekt powinien ustawić sam 0% | Subiekt powinien ustawić sam 0% |
| 4. Kontrahent UE B2C, procedura OSS | Tak | brak | UE | konieczny | Wewnątrzwspólnotowa sprzedaż towarów na odległość – WSTO (OSS) | Subiekt powinien ustawić stawkę kraju docelowego | Subiekt powinien ustawić stawkę kraju docelowego |
| 5. Kontrahent UE B2C, sprzedaż poniżej limitu, bez NIP w kraju docelowym | Tak – Wyłączona auto-obsługa OSS | brak | UE | konieczny | Wewnątrzwspólnotowa sprzedaż towarów na odległość – WSTO | Subiekt powinien ustawić sam z karty | Subiekt powinien ustawić sam z karty |
| 6. Kontrahent UE B2C, sprzedaż powyżej limitu, nadany NIP w kraju docelowym | Nie | brak | UE | konieczny | Wewnątrzwspólnotowa sprzedaż towarów na odległość – WSTO | Subiekt powinien ustawić stawkę kraju docelowego | Subiekt powinien ustawić stawkę kraju docelowego |
| 7. Kontrahent poza UE B2B | Tak | Tak | poza UE | konieczny | Eksport towarów (poza UE) ex | Subiekt powinien ustawić stawkę 0% lub krajowy wg konfiguracji | Subiekt powinien ustawić stawkę 0% lub krajowy wg konfiguracji |
| 8. Kontrahent poza UE B2C | Tak | brak | poza UE | konieczny | Eksport towarów (poza UE) ex | Subiekt powinien ustawić stawkę 0% lub krajowy wg konfiguracji | Subiekt powinien ustawić stawkę 0% lub krajowy wg konfiguracji |
| 9. Kontrahent poza terytorium kraju B2B/B2C | Nie | brak | poza UE | konieczny | Sprzedaż poza terytorium kraju | Subiekt powinien ustawić stawkę 0% | Subiekt powinien ustawić stawkę 0% |
| 10. Kontrahent poza terytorium kraju B2C/B2B | Nie | brak | poza UE | konieczny | Sprzedaż poza terytorium kraju | Subiekt powinien ustawić stawkę 0% lub krajowy wg konfiguracji | Subiekt powinien ustawić stawkę 0% |
Jeśli opcja Ustaw typ transakcji na podstawie numeru NIP nie jest włączona, rozróżnienie między scenariuszem B2B i B2C nie będzie działało w ten sam sposób.
O czym warto pamiętać
- Ten mechanizm nie dotyczy wyłącznie procedury OSS. Jest używany także przy sprzedaży zagranicznej bez OSS.
- Dla sprzedaży B2C do UE włączenie lub wyłączenie procedury OSS wpływa na typ transakcji zapisywany w Subiekt Nexo.
- Dla sprzedaży B2B do UE kluczowe jest poprawne rozpoznanie kontrahenta jako podmiotu z numerem NIP.
- Po zmianie ustawień integracji warto wykonać ponowną synchronizację testowego zamówienia i sprawdzić zapis dokumentu w Subiekt Nexo.